ELKHART — Barbara Anne Meyer Jabs, 76, of Elkhart, passed away at Eastlake Nursing and Rehabilitation Center at 7:35 a.m. Sunday, May 18.
She was born Feb. 10, 1938, in Passaic, N.J., to the late Alfred and Anne (Franko) Meyer.
Surviving are her sons, Tim (Kathy) and Russell Jabs, both of Elkhart, and Christopher Jabs of Jacksonville, Fla.; daughters Susan (Gary) McKee of Arlington Heights, Ill., Lori (Bryan) Dygert of Bristol and Amy (Tate) Stuntz of Noblesville; her brother, Alfred (Carol) Meyer of North Las Vegas; grandchildren Courtney Lyons-Crawford, Sarah, Nick and Megan McKee, Christian and Calvin Jabs, Hannah, Bradley and Haley Dygert, Emily and Julia Stuntz; and great-grandson Jaymeson Crawford. Also surviving is her former spouse, Richard Jabs, of Elkhart.
A gathering of friends and family will take place from 7 to 8 p.m. Friday, May 23, at Billings Funeral Home of Elkhart, followed by a funeral service there at 8 p.m. Sister Nora Frost will officiate and, in accordance with the family's wishes, cremation will follow the services.
Barbara worked in the classified advertising department at The Elkhart Truth for over 30 years. She was a wonderful mother, grandmother and great-grandmother, as well as being a prolific reader, and was a member of Grace Lutheran Church.
